Core Skills & Abilities

  • Produce electronics drawings or other graphics representing industrial control, instrumentation, sensors, or analog or digital telecommunications networks, using computer-aided design (CAD) software.

  • Interpret test information to resolve design-related problems.

  • Supervise the installation or operation of electronic equipment or systems.

  • Construct and evaluate electrical components for consumer electronics applications such as fuel cells for consumer electronic devices, power saving devices for computers or televisions, or energy efficient power chargers.

  • Research equipment or component needs, sources, competitive prices, delivery times, or ongoing operational costs.

  • Specify, coordinate, or conduct quality control or quality assurance programs or procedures.

  • Review, develop, or prepare maintenance standards.

  • Conduct statistical studies to analyze or compare production costs for sustainable or nonsustainable designs.

  • Maintain system logs or manuals to document testing or operation of equipment.

  • Integrate software or hardware components, using computer, microprocessor, or control architecture.

  • Design or modify engineering schematics for electrical transmission and distribution systems or for electrical installation in residential, commercial, or industrial buildings, using computer-aided design (CAD) software.

  • Modify electrical prototypes, parts, assemblies, or systems to correct functional deviations.

  • Identify and resolve equipment malfunctions, working with manufacturers or field representatives as necessary to procure replacement parts.

  • Participate in the development or testing of electrical aspects of new green technologies, such as lighting, optical data storage devices, and energy efficient televisions.

  • Select electronics equipment, components, or systems to meet functional specifications.

  • Calculate design specifications or cost, material, and resource estimates, and prepare project schedules and budgets.

  • Procure parts and maintain inventory and related documentation.

  • Review existing electrical engineering criteria to identify necessary revisions, deletions, or amendments to outdated material.

  • Educate equipment operators on the proper use of equipment.

  • Assemble, test, or maintain circuitry or electronic components, according to engineering instructions, technical manuals, or knowledge of electronics, using hand or power tools.

  • Set up and operate specialized or standard test equipment to diagnose, test, or analyze the performance of electronic components, assemblies, or systems.

  • Assemble electrical systems or prototypes, using hand tools or measuring instruments.

  • Review electrical engineering plans to ensure adherence to design specifications and compliance with applicable electrical codes and standards.

  • Install or maintain electrical control systems, industrial automation systems, or electrical equipment, including control circuits, variable speed drives, or programmable logic controllers.

  • Provide user applications or engineering support or recommendations for new or existing equipment with regard to installation, upgrades, or enhancements.

  • Read blueprints, wiring diagrams, schematic drawings, or engineering instructions for assembling electronics units, applying knowledge of electronic theory and components.

  • Participate in training or continuing education activities to stay abreast of engineering or industry advances.

  • Modify, maintain, or repair electronics equipment or systems to ensure proper functioning.

  • Replace defective components or parts, using hand tools and precision instruments.

  • Compile and maintain records documenting engineering schematics, installed equipment, installation or operational problems, resources used, repairs, or corrective action performed.
